Why Tree Care Matters in Atlantic Highlands
Atlantic Highlands offers one of the most distinctive landscapes in Monmouth County. Its rolling hills, elevated properties overlooking Sandy Hook Bay, and mature residential neighborhoods create beautiful settings for large shade trees and ornamental landscapes. These same characteristics also create unique maintenance considerations.
Steeper grades can influence drainage and root stability, while strong coastal winds regularly place additional stress on tree canopies. Salt carried inland during coastal storms can also affect tree health over time, particularly for species that are less tolerant of coastal conditions. Mature trees growing near homes or overlooking steep slopes benefit from regular inspections that help identify structural concerns before severe weather arrives.

Protecting Trees in a Coastal Environment
Trees growing near the coast face environmental conditions that differ from those farther inland. Salt exposure, changing moisture levels, high winds, and occasional severe storms can all affect tree growth over time. Proactive care helps trees adapt to these conditions while reducing the likelihood of unexpected failures.
Regular inspections, responsible pruning, healthy soil management, and ongoing plant health care all contribute to stronger trees that continue to provide shade, beauty, and value for years to come. FAQ
How do coastal conditions affect trees in Atlantic Highlands?
Salt air, coastal winds, and severe storms can place additional stress on trees over time. Routine maintenance helps improve tree health and identify potential issues before they become more serious.
How often should mature trees be inspected?
Most mature trees benefit from professional inspections every few years. Trees growing near homes, steep slopes, or high-traffic areas may require more frequent evaluations.
What are common signs that a tree may need professional care?
Dead branches, thinning foliage, fungal growth, trunk cracks, leaning, or poor seasonal growth are all signs that a tree should be evaluated.
Can preventative tree care reduce storm damage?
Routine pruning, plant health care, and regular inspections can improve tree structure and reduce the likelihood of storm-related branch failures.
